Integration Software Engineer

at  VNova

London W2, England, United Kingdom -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ate27 Oct, 2024Not Specified29 Jul, 2024N/AAndroid,Operating Systems,Computer ScienceN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

Overview:
Integration Software Engineer (C++, codec OS and browser integration)
Joining us as an Integration Team Software Engineer will give you the opportunity to work in multiple development environments with the latest video compression technology. This is a great chance to join a dynamic team, where you will experience a variety of work with some of the biggest names in media, from large social media companies through to TV manufacturers. This will also give you a good chance to develop and grow your career with a diverse, multiskilled team around you.

Responsibilities:

  • The primary responsibility will be developing and maintaining the integration of LCEVC (MPEG5 Part 2) into multiple operating systems such as Android, Chromium, WebRTC, JavaScript based web decoders.
  • Example projects include adding support for HDR content playback on mobile platforms or enabling LCEVC playback on web browsers.
  • Working with the decoder and encoder teams to support maintenance and improvements in the core C++ codec integration layers.
  • Integration work for other V-Nova compression solutions, such as VC6 and Point Cloud Compression, into different video editing and creation applications.
  • Engaging with the open source community to contribute changes upstream to video player Open Source projects and assist with their integration of LCEVC.
  • Resolve defects within the codec integration layer and different integrations.
  • Sprint planning and refinement sessions discussing new features or issues to resolve during the upcoming sprint.
  • Participate in daily stand-up meetings and report back status, issues and successes.

Qualifications:

QUALIFICATIONS:

  • A degree in Computer Science, Engineering, other relevant scientific/technical subjects, or work experience.
  • Experience developing C/C++ software.
  • Interest in developing system level software for iOS, Android or desktop operating systems for use by third party applications.
  • Interest in expanding your knowledge of video codecs and video streaming technology.

Responsibilities:

  • The primary responsibility will be developing and maintaining the integration of LCEVC (MPEG5 Part 2) into multiple operating systems such as Android, Chromium, WebRTC, JavaScript based web decoders.
  • Example projects include adding support for HDR content playback on mobile platforms or enabling LCEVC playback on web browsers.
  • Working with the decoder and encoder teams to support maintenance and improvements in the core C++ codec integration layers.
  • Integration work for other V-Nova compression solutions, such as VC6 and Point Cloud Compression, into different video editing and creation applications.
  • Engaging with the open source community to contribute changes upstream to video player Open Source projects and assist with their integration of LCEVC.
  • Resolve defects within the codec integration layer and different integrations.
  • Sprint planning and refinement sessions discussing new features or issues to resolve during the upcoming sprint.
  • Participate in daily stand-up meetings and report back status, issues and successes


REQUIREMENT SUMMARY

Min:N/AMax:5.0 year(s)

Computer Software/Engineering

IT Software - Application Programming / Maintenance

Software Engineering

Graduate

Computer Science, Engineering

Proficient

1

London W2, United Kingdom